Script for Mini Brief:
Before we started to film our mini brief, we needed to write a script for the sequence. As we wanted our sequence to be about a football player who got injured, we had a football player and a doctor. We also wanted to have a sad ending with the doctor saying its bad news to the player. We wanted to make the sequence very emotional, and have the main aim of provoking a reaction from the audience by making them feel for the player.
Main characters:
Adam – Aspiring footballer hoping to move up the ranks of his football club West Ham, but something tragic gets in the way of his progress
Doctor – Explains to Adam what the situation
SCRIPT:
(Screen comes on but in the medical room)
(Door opens doctor walks in)
Doctor: Morning Adam
Adam: wait what…..where am I? What’s happened? Who are you......? Why am I not on the pitch!
Doctor: Calm down, Calm down just let me explain the situation. So you don’t remember anything at all?
Adam: NO! Tell me what’s going on
Doctor: breathe Adam, so what’s happened is yesterday you were involved in an accident in your game
Adam: YESTERDAY! What happened…….? Did we win?
Doctor: Basically it’s not good news, we have x-rayed you and you have several bones broken in your leg and severe damage to your ligaments
(Pause)
Adam: so what does that mean to my career?
Doctor: you’ll be booked in for surgery on your right leg and you’ll look to be out for the next 2 years
(Extreme close up on Adam’s face)
